Capital Project Levy and EP&O Levy
** UPDATE: Both Levies Pass!! **
Great News, Orcas Island!
Both of our school levies have officially passed and will be certified on 11/26/2025! Our EP&O Levy earned a strong 68% approval, and the Capital Levy passed with 62%—a tremendous show of support.

Why two levies?
State funding only provides for basic educational needs, leaving a significant gap in delivering the well-rounded education our families expect and our students deserve. Local levies bridge this gap by funding essential programs, staffing, and facilities, ensuring our students enjoy opportunities comparable to those in neighboring districts.
Each levy serves specific purposes, but together, they create a comprehensive approach to support our students.
PROPOSITION 1: Capital Projects Levy for Sitework & Safety Improvements
The Capital Projects Levy will fund much-needed improvements to the Orcas Island School District campus grounds.
Over the years, driveways, parking lots, and walkways have deteriorated, creating safety risks for students, families, and staff. This levy provides the funding needed to make long-overdue upgrades that improve safety, accessibility, and student opportunities.
Improvements include:
- Eliminate the potholes
- Paving driveways and parking areas
- Installing ADA walkways
- Upgrading LED site lighting
- Adding a shotput and discus competition area so OISD can host track meets
- OISD campus site and safety improvements
PROPOSITION 2: Educational Programs & Operations (EP&O) Levy
This levy will fund a portion of the educational programs and operations not funded or fully funded by the State of Washington. Local levy funding allows us to provide the quality education our community expects for our children, which goes beyond the minimum funding provided by the state.
The Educational Programs & Operations Levy helps pay for:
- Music, art, farm to classroom and outdoor education
- Athletics, clubs, and student activities with transportation
- Nursing and mental health services
- Special education programs
- Supplies and maintenance
